Precision and Skills: Mercedes Diagnostics in Tauranga
Mercedes-Benz is synonymous with luxurious, efficiency, and slicing-edge technological innovation. Maintaining these Excellent autos in ideal problem needs specialized awareness and advanced diagnostic applications. In Tauranga, New Zealand, Mercedes diagnostics products and services give you the important skills necessary to keep and restore Merce